About Raining Blood "Raining Blood" is a song by the American thrash metal band Slayer. Written by Jeff Hanneman and Kerry King for the 1986 studio album Reign in Blood, the song's religious concept is about overthrowing Heaven. The song is four minutes and fourteen seconds in duration. It ends with a minute of rain sound effects.
